Planning a party doesn’t have to mean producing heaps of waste. At Friendly Turtle’s EcoBlog, we believe themed gatherings can be joyful and eco-conscious. Ditch the single-use plastic and opt for experiences that bring people together - like murder mystery kits, board game nights, or garden Olympics. Encourage guests to create outfits from what they already own or recycled materials, reducing textile waste. Skip the plastic favours - send guests home with seeds, handmade snacks or bath bombs instead. Choose reusable decorations or rent what you need; potted plants and citrus garlands add beauty with minimal impact. Whether it’s a garden party, tea party or DIY costume night, a little creativity goes a long way. Celebrate sustainably and inspire your guests to do the same. Hosting a green gathering isn’t just stylish - it’s a meaningful way to care for the planet while making lasting memories.

Advantages of Using Reusable Eco-Friendly Cups

Some beverage and coffee cups may be made of paper, to make it seem like they are biodegradable and you don't have to worry about discarding them after use. However, they are usually treated with chemicals that could make them take too long to decompose. The same goes for plastic water bottles. That means they could stay in a landfill for many years. In some cases, they end up littering natural areas like oceans and forests. You can minimise their impact on the environment by switching to reusable eco-friendly cups and reusable water bottles in the UK. These products also reduce the need to keep relying on single-use plastics.
The best thing about eco-friendly cups and water bottles is they can be reused many times without any problems. Just make sure they are made of high-quality durable materials that are BPA-free. Many of them are dishwasher safe, so they can easily be cleaned. They also eliminate the need to keep buying drinks packaged in disposable, single-use plastic vessels. If you run out of water, simply head to a drinking fountain or water dispenser for a refill. That way, you are not only doing your part in minimising your impact on the environment, but you are also making an effort to save money. Some coffee shops may even offer discounts if you have your reusable cup where they can put your preferred beverage.
Reusable water bottles in the UK are stylish to carry and use. They come in many different designs and sizes, so you should be able to find the perfect beverage container that suits your taste and lifestyle. The same holds true with eco-friendly cups, so you can enjoy your favourite beverages in style.
It is easy to purchase reusable water bottles and cups these days, as there are online shops that carry them from different brands and manufacturers. Consider buying from a reputable zero waste shop, so you can be confident that you are using environmentally friendly products.
